Как ролить в Чат АИ: создание идеального бота для текстовых приключений

Текстовые ролевые игры пережили второе рождение — и виноваты в этом, как ни странно, нейросети. Когда-то любители отыгрыша часами искали себе партнёра на тематических форумах, ждали ответов сутками, а то и неделями, и нередко сталкивались с тем, что собеседник пропадал на самом интересном моменте. Сейчас же роль мастера, антагониста или загадочного спутника берёт на себя языковая модель, готовая отвечать в три часа ночи и не устающая от двадцатой попытки переиграть сцену. Но чтобы магия сработала, мало просто открыть чат и написать «давай поролим» — нужен грамотно собранный бот, продуманный сценарий и понимание того, как с этой системой разговаривать.

Играть в текстовые ролевые игры бесплатно

«Ролить» — что это вообще значит?

Слово пришло из англоязычной среды (от «role-play») и прижилось в русском геймерском сленге настолько, что давно потеряло кавычки. Ролить — значит отыгрывать персонажа в вымышленных обстоятельствах, описывая его действия, мысли и реплики от первого или третьего лица. В связке с нейросетью это превращается в интерактивную книгу, где читатель одновременно автор. Чат отвечает за окружение, NPC, последствия решений, а пользователь ведёт своего героя. Звучит просто? На деле — задача не из лёгких.

Ведь модель без чёткой настройки скатывается в шаблонные ответы, теряет нить сюжета, забывает имена и начинает писать за вашего персонажа. А это, пожалуй, главный кошмар любого ролевика.

С чего начать сборку бота?

С характера. Не с внешности, не с биографии, а именно с характера — стержня, вокруг которого нарастёт всё остальное. Многие новички совершают одну и ту же ошибку: расписывают цвет глаз, рост, гардероб и любимую еду, а потом удивляются, почему персонаж получился картонным. Дело в том, что внешние атрибуты модель воспроизводит легко, а вот мотивацию, страхи и манеру речи — только при условии, что вы их явно прописали. Стоит начать с одного-двух определяющих качеств: «циничный, но сентиментальный наёмник», «холодная аристократка с тщательно скрываемой жаждой признания». Дальше — речевой портрет: лексика, любимые присказки, табу. И только потом — антураж, оружие, шрамы, плащ с капюшоном.

Системный промт и его подводные камни

Системный промт — это инструкция, которую модель получает до начала диалога. По сути, фундамент всего отыгрыша. И если фундамент кривой, то и здание поплывёт. В представлении многих новичков хороший промт — это длинный документ на пять тысяч слов, где расписано всё, вплоть до завтрака персонажа. Но на самом деле перегруженность вредит. Модель начинает теряться в деталях, выдавать противоречия, путать факты.

Текстовые ролевые игры с ИИ — прямо в Telegram 🎭

Большой выбор готовых персонажей и сюжетов на любой вкус: фэнтези, романтика, детектив, мистика, повседневность. Каждый герой со своим характером и манерой речи. Просто откройте бота, выберите персонажа — и вы уже внутри истории.

Выбрать персонажа и начать игру 👉 https://clck.ru/3Ta8kQ

Оптимальный объём — от полутора до трёх тысяч знаков, в которые упакованы личность, сеттинг, правила взаимодействия и запреты. Именно блок запретов часто работает лучше любых положительных инструкций.

К слову, формулировки вроде «не пиши за пользователя», «не завершай сцену без согласия», «не ломай четвёртую стену» моделью считываются жёстче. Запрет конкретнее. Он точнее.

Сеттинг — без него никуда

Мир, в котором происходит действие, важен ничуть не меньше героев. Постапокалиптическая пустошь, викторианский Лондон с примесью оккультизма, орбитальная станция в эпоху корпоративных войн — каждый сеттинг диктует свою логику, свой язык, свой набор допустимого. Не стоит надеяться, что нейросеть сама догадается, есть ли в вашем фэнтези порох или магия его подавляет. Подобные мелочи нужно прописать заранее, иначе бот начнёт смешивать жанры, и герой с мечом внезапно достанет револьвер. Хорошо работает приём «три кита»: эпоха, технологический уровень, главная магическая или социальная особенность. Этого скелета модели обычно хватает, чтобы держать антураж в рамках.

Как заставить бота не писать за вас?

Это, пожалуй, самая частая боль. Сидишь, погружаешься в сцену, а модель радостно описывает, как «вы достали меч и нанесли удар». Стоп. Меч доставали вы или она за вас решила? Лечится эта болячка тремя способами. Во-первых, прямой запрет в системном промте — формулировка вроде «никогда не описывай действия, мысли и реплики персонажа пользователя, только реагируй на них». Во-вторых, личный пример: первые два-три сообщения задают тон, и если вы сами чётко отделяете действия своего героя курсивом или маркерами, бот это считывает. Ну и, наконец, регулярная коррекция — не стесняйтесь редактировать ответы модели, удалять лишнее, переписывать концовки реплик.

Память, контекст и его границы

Главный технический нюанс ролевого отыгрыша — ограниченное окно контекста. Модель помнит ровно столько, сколько помещается в её рабочий буфер, и всё, что вылетело за его пределы, теряется. Что было сто сообщений назад? Туман. Имя трактирщика из второй главы? Забыто. Лечится это саммари — краткими выжимками, которые игрок периодически вставляет в чат: «Напоминаю: герой ранен в плечо, в кармане письмо от графа, союзник Эльвира ждёт у моста». Это рутина, не самая увлекательная часть процесса. Зато без неё длинная сюжетная арка рассыплется уже к десятому витку.

Многие платформы предлагают встроенные «лорбуки» или базы знаний — туда складывается информация, которая подгружается только при упоминании конкретных триггеров. Решение элегантное и экономящее контекст.

Стиль повествования

Какой манеры письма ждать от бота? Той, которую вы зададите. Если хотите неспешную литературную прозу с описаниями запахов и теней — пропишите это явно, приведите пример абзаца. Любите динамичные сцены в духе боевика — задайте ритм короткими рублеными фразами. Без образца модель по умолчанию выдаст усреднённый «средний стиль», довольно безликий и пресный. А вот пара эталонных фрагментов творит чудеса. Особый интерес вызывает приём «двойного зеркала»: вы пишете свой ответ в желаемой манере, а в инструкции просите бота отвечать в схожем темпе и регистре. Через пять-семь обменов реплик стилистика устаканивается, и текст начинает звучать слаженно, будто его пишут в четыре руки.

Конфликты, ставки и драматургия

Скучный отыгрыш — это не плохая модель. Это отсутствие конфликта. Сколько ни прописывай характеров, если в сцене нечего терять, диалог превращается в светскую беседу. Стоит закладывать в стартовую ситуацию явное напряжение: ультиматум, тикающие часы, моральный выбор. И не лениться повышать ставки по ходу действия. Бот сам редко эскалирует — у моделей вшита тенденция к сглаживанию углов, к компромиссам и хэппи-эндам. Поэтому драматургию приходится вести игроку. Хотите предательство? Намекните на него за десять сообщений. Хотите неожиданный поворот? Подкиньте боту артефакт или письмо, которое тот обязан как-то отыграть.

NSFW и прочие острые темы

Тема щепетильная, но обойти её нельзя. Львиная доля ролевых сценариев так или иначе уходит в романтику, насилие или мрачную психологию. И тут многое зависит от платформы: одни сервисы фильтруют такой контент жёстко, другие позволяют практически всё, третьи дают настраивать уровень самостоятельно. Не стоит лезть в обход правил конкретного сервиса — обычно это заканчивается баном аккаунта. Лучше изначально выбрать инструмент под свои задачи. Для умеренно тёмного фэнтези подойдёт почти любой современный чат, для жёстких сценариев — специализированные платформы с открытыми настройками.

Типичные ошибки, на которых всплывут проблемы

Ошибок ровно столько, сколько и желающих ролить, но несколько встречаются чаще всех. Первая — расплывчатый персонаж без внутреннего конфликта. Вторая — игрок, который сам не отыгрывает, а только командует: «опиши, как он подходит, опиши, как она отвечает». Бот в такой схеме превращается в писателя-подёнщика, а не в партнёра. Третья беда — игнор саммари и попытка играть на дистанциях, превышающих контекстное окно. Четвёртая — отсутствие правок: модель ошиблась раз, ошиблась два, а игрок терпит, и эти ошибки накапливаются снежным комом. Ну и пятая, самая болезненная — желание получить идеальный текст с первого свайпа. Так не бывает даже у живых соавторов, что уж говорить о машине.

А стоит ли вообще заморачиваться?

Резонный вопрос. Ведь можно открыть готовую карточку персонажа на любом популярном сервисе и начать играть прямо сейчас, без всякой инженерной возни. Чужой бот не передаст тех ощущений.

Это как разница между арендованной комнатой и домом, который вы построили сами. Свой персонаж знает ваши вкусы, реагирует на ваши намёки, ведёт сюжет туда, куда хочется именно вам.

Да и сам процесс настройки — отдельное удовольствие, сродни написанию небольшой повести. Сначала мучаешься, переписываешь, ругаешься на модель, потом находишь нужные формулировки — и бот вдруг оживает. Момент, когда впервые ловишь себя на мысли «он ответил именно так, как ответил бы реальный человек», стоит всех потраченных часов.

Играть в текстовые ролевые игры бесплатно

Несколько практических хитростей напоследок

Стоит вести отдельный файл с заготовками — описаниями локаций, репликами NPC, обрывками диалогов, которые пригодятся позже. Полезно периодически устраивать «таймскипы», когда вы кратко описываете, что произошло за прошедшее время, и бот подхватывает повествование с новой точки. Не стоит бояться играть несколькими персонажами одновременно: модель прекрасно держит двух-трёх собеседников, если каждому прописан свой голос. И, разумеется, имеет смысл сохранять понравившиеся сцены — пусть это останется у вас как небольшой личный архив, к которому приятно вернуться через полгода.

Текстовые приключения с нейросетью — то самое поле, где техника встречается с воображением, и побеждает тот, кто умеет дружить с обеими сторонами. Настройка бота поначалу кажется махинацией с десятком параметров, но через две-три истории всё становится интуитивным. Удачи в создании собственных миров — и пусть ваш следующий герой запомнится надолго.